Buying Guide

When you’re outfitting a college apartment or dorm room the right way, small choices add up. Here’s a short buying guide to help you pick which organizers and tools will actually make daily life easier.

What to prioritize
– Space efficiency: Look for vertical, cascading, or multi-hook designs that multiply hanging capacity. If your closet rod is short, a 6-pack cascading hanger saves more space than single bulky wooden hangers.
– Versatility: Multi-hole hangers or swivel hooks let you store bras, scarves, tank tops, belts, and even folded sweaters in the same slot.
– Durability vs price: Plastic hangers and organizers are lightweight and inexpensive; metal or thicker molded plastic lasts longer for heavy items. Consider a mixed approach—plastic for shirts, metal for accessories.
– Ease of use: If you’ll be grabbing clothes in a rush between classes, smooth hooks and 360° swivel features reduce fumbling. Non-slip surfaces or notches help keep straps and thin fabrics from sliding off.

Sizing and quantity
– Assess closet depth and rod height first. Many space-saver hangers work best when you can hang them in cascades or stackers. A 6-pack or 10-pack gives quick gains; single-pack specialty pieces are best for targeted needs.
– Start with one or two multi-hole organizers for scarves and undergarments and a 6-pack of cascading hangers for shirts/pants; you can add more once you see how much vertical space is freed.

Materials and care
– Plastic is lightweight and easy to wipe; metal holds shape better but may rust in high-humidity areas—look for coated finishes.
– Avoid overly fragile clips or thin hooks if you own heavier knitwear or jackets.

Tool kit considerations
– For dorms, a compact 20–40 piece kit covers most furniture assembly, picture hanging, and quick fixes. Professional-grade tools aren’t necessary—look for a balanced set with a hammer, screwdriver with interchangeable bits, pliers, tape measure, and a small level.

Alternatives to know
– Traditional wooden hangers look premium but eat space. Wire hangers are cheap but bend and crease clothes. The space-saving organizers below tend to be a better middle ground for apartment living.

Who shouldn’t bother
– If you commute and leave most clothes at home, or if you have a walk-in closet, you may not need aggressive space-saving gear. Likewise, if you prefer professional repair tools or a full garage toolkit, the small dorm kit won’t replace heavy-duty equipment.

Follow these principles and you’ll buy fewer items that actually make day-to-day life simpler—exactly what you need in a tight college apartment.
